On Tuesday morning, the tax authorities released revenue listings in 2017. The figures for Møre og Romsdal show that there are two health services that had the highest income last year.
In addition, we find Optimar Håvard Sætre, CEO of Tennfjord. He had a taxable income of more than NOK 36 million. Jan-Henrik Henriksen of Ålesund followed revenues of NOK 31.5 million and Marius Kjærstad in Kristiansund with NOK 31.3 million.
The first person with an address in the scattered Odd Roald Haukås region of Molde is in fifth place where we have a taxable income of NOK 29 million. Bernt Lodve Gjendemsjø of Fræny is seventh with 25.5 million, while two of the Aas brothers in the Vestnes have finished ten in the top list, both with just over NOK 19 million in earnings.
